Mortgage risk: A hot export

Article Abstract:

There is speculation that the home mortgage market in the United States could blow out. United States mortgage banks have been exporting risk of defaults to European and Asian investors.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corp. and Federal National Mortgage Association's market share is down.

Fannie Mae board agrees to changes it long resisted: mortgage giant to revamp accounting, boost capital; executives remain in place

Article Abstract:

Fannie Mae has agreed to changes mandated by the Office of Federal Housing Enterprise Oversight. The federal government wants to slow the growth of the mortgage company and protect it from potential financial distress.

Mortgage hot potatoes: banks try to return high-risk loans to the originators

Article Abstract:

With increasing numbers of Americans having difficulty paying their mortgages, large banks are trying to get mortgage brokers to repurchase high-risk housing loans.
